Course overview

Creative communication specialists are increasingly in demand in a range of industries, government and communities. The Bachelor of Communication prepares students for a lifetime of creative and critical use of media and communication in our fast-paced, ever-changing digital landscape. With a strong foundation in writing, industry engagement (including internships), practice and production skills, students develop expertise in multimedia and online content production, social media engagement and analytics, community and stakeholder engagement, and campaign development throughout the program. Specialise in either Strategic Communication or Digital Media and complement this choice alongside a second major or a minor or general electives. English requirement
IELTS Academic 6.5, no band below 6PTE Academic 64, no component below 60TOEFL iBT 87 (L 19 / R 19 / W 21 / S 19)

If your current English result is below direct entry, consider the university-recognised English language pathway or ELICOS package; successful completion at the required level can usually satisfy English entry without another English test.
